Overview
Telecom Lookup Tools

Cart - Backorder Add

This allows you to have a single shopping cart, where you add all of your phone numbers to a single order, and then close out the cart.

Post/ Get Information

URL:

https://apiv1.teleapi.net/backorder/cart?token=XXXXX

Argument

Required

Type

Example

state

yes

string

CO

ratecenter

yes

string

DENVER

quantity

yes

int

2

Note: You will need to close the backorder out immediately if you are just backordering for one ratecenter/state. You can do that by.

Add a backorder for a state/ratecenter.

shell
PHP+CURL
PHP+PLAIN
RESPONSE
shell

Shell/CURL

curl -v -X GET "https://apiv1.teleapi.net/backorder/cart?token=XXXX&ratecenter=DENVER&STATE=CO&quantity=2"
PHP+CURL

Using PHP+CURL

<?php
$data = array("state" => "CO",
"ratecenter" => "DENVER",
"quantity" => "3"
);
$data = http_build_query($data);
$baseurl = "https://apiv1.teleapi.net/backorder/cart?token=XXXX&".$data;
curl_setopt($ch, CURLOPT_RETURNTRANSFER, 1);
$retval = curl_exec($ch);
curl_close($ch);
$object = json_decode($retval);
print_r($object);
PHP+PLAIN

PHP - file_get_contents

<?php
$data = array("did_number" => "3035551212"
);
$data = array("state" => "CO",
"ratecenter" => "DENVER",
"quantity" => "3"
);
$url = "https://apiv1.teleapi.net/backorder/cart?token=XXXX&".$data;
$x = file_get_contents($url);
$object = json_decode($x);
print_r($object);
RESPONSE

Successful Addition to Cart

{
"code":200,
"status":"success",
"data":"successfully added item to cart"
}

Failed Adding (Number not Available)

{
"code": 400,
"status": "error",
"data": "invalid did id"
}